dBZ stands for decibels of Z. It is a meteorological measure of equivalent reflectivity (Z) of a radar signal reflected off a remote object.[1] The reference level for Z is 1 mm6 m-3, which is equal to 1 μm3. It is related to the number of drops per unit volume and the sixth power of drop diameter.
Reflectivity of a cloud is dependent on the number and type of hydrometeors, which includes rain, snow, and hail, and the hydrometeors size. A large number of small hydrometeors will reflect the same as one large hydrometeor. The signal returned to the radar will be equivalent in both situations so a group of small hydrometeors is virtually indistinguishable from one large hydrometeor on the resulting radar image.
A meteorologist can determine the difference between one large hydrometeor and a group of small hydrometeors as well as the type of hydrometeor through knowledge of local weather condition contexts.
